The Exo Terra Reptile UVB300 is specifically tailored for reptiles that thrive in environments with intense, direct sunlight, such as deserts or open savannahs.

With its 14% UVB output, this bulb delivers the highest UV intensity among the T5 series, meeting the needs of reptiles requiring high levels of UVB exposure. Supporting Ferguson Zones 3-4 and the Euphotic and Heliophotic Zones, it provides the UVB necessary for open and mid-day sun baskers. The UVB300 is critical for maximizing vitamin D3 synthesis, which is essential for robust bone growth, healthy shells, and preventing metabolic bone disease (MBD). This bulb is ideal for large enclosures or terrariums with minimal shading, replicating the intense sunlight found in arid and semi-arid regions. Its high UV output ensures reptiles receive adequate exposure even at greater distances from the bulb. To avoid overexposure, the positioning and distance from the basking area should be carefully considered. When used alongside basking lights and proper thermal setups, the UVB300 creates a complete and enriching environment that supports the health and natural behaviors of reptiles in high-UV habitats.

Keepers can use the UV Index reference values to ensure that animals are exposed to an appropriate level of UV when basking. The intensity of the emissions varies depending on the distance from the basking area. Creating a gradient – from highest safe UV index at the basking area to lowest UV index in cooler areas – means they can completely self-regulate alongside their thermoregulatory behaviours. They should not be allowed to expose themselves to more than a safe maximum and should have the freedom to escape all light completely with areas of zero UV and Infrared. This can be achieved by strategically adding plants, hides, and decorative items to create shaded zones.

The UV radiation output of all UV-emitting bulbs gradually decreases over time. To ensure your animals consistently receive sufficient UV exposure, we recommend replacing the Exo Terra® Reptile UVB T5 tube — or any other UV bulb — at least every 12 months.


To support the efficient conversion of vitamin D3 and enhance various metabolic and hormonal processes, it is beneficial to ensure that UV light exposure is complemented by an ample supply of infrared-A (NIR) radiation. The most effective sources can be found in Tungsten Halogen or standard Incandescent spot bulbs, such as the Exo Terra Intense Basking Spot or Halogen Basking Spot. This combination promotes optimal body temperature regulation and overall well-being.
